Standard Guide Wires

Standard guide wires are the most commonly used type during PTCA procedures. Typically, these wires possess a smooth surface and a moderate stiffness that balances flexibility and support. They are designed to navigate through the intricate vascular anatomy and can easily pass through moderate to highly tortuous vessels. Standard guide wires usually come in various lengths and diameters, allowing physicians to select the appropriate specifications based on individual patient needs and the complexity of the case.

Hydrophilic Guide Wires

Hydrophilic guide wires are coated with a special hydrophilic polymer that absorbs moisture, allowing the wire to glide more smoothly over the arterial surfaces. This unique feature makes them particularly useful for navigating tight or complicated lesions, significantly reducing friction and trauma during insertion. Hydrophilic guide wires are ideal for patients with complex anatomies where traditional wires may face challenges.

Stiff Guide Wires

Stiff guide wires feature increased rigidity compared to standard wires. They are particularly beneficial in cases where significant support is needed, such as in heavily calcified lesions or when attempting to navigate through challenging arterial bifurcations. The greater support provided by stiff guide wires facilitates the successful delivery of balloons and stents, making them an indispensable tool in specific interventional scenarios.

Flexible Guide Wires

On the contrary, flexible guide wires are engineered to provide enhanced maneuverability within the vascular system. These wires can navigate through intricate curves and branches in the coronary arteries with ease. Flexible guide wires are often preferred in cases where the vessel anatomy is highly complex, allowing for better access and instrument delivery without causing additional trauma to the vessel walls.

Extra Support Guide Wires

Extra support guide wires are a hybrid of both stiff and standard wires. They combine rigidity with an adequate level of flexibility, making them versatile tools for various interventional procedures. These wires are particularly suited for cases involving challenging lesions or those requiring extended navigation through long or tortuous arteries. Their balanced properties provide both support and the ability to navigate curves effectively.

Micro-Guide Wires

Micro-guide wires are ultra-thin wires designed for use in smaller vessels or for very specific procedures, such as dealing with atherosclerotic plaque lesions. They can navigate through various catheters and are beneficial in situations where a precise approach is necessary. These guide wires allow interventional cardiologists to perform complex procedures with greater accuracy and less risk of damage to surrounding tissues.
